Property Description
Bedrooms: 3. Bathrooms: 2
Cataloochee Mountain Cabin is a comfortable 3/2 log cabin that rests
3,300 feet in elevation in the Great Smoky Mountains! Come relax and
unwind in this practically new authentic log cabin home. You will
have lots of privacy on our 1+ acre wooded lot.
Our spacious
3 bedroom 2 bath home has a beautiful stone fireplace (wood burning)
which separates the large living room from the dining room. Cabin
has hardwood floors, cathedral ceilings, carpeted bedrooms, and a
fully equipped kitchen. Many extras are included in this exceptional
home. Cabin sleeps up to 10 with 2 queen beds, 2 twin beds,
comfortable sleeper sofa, and queen air mattress. Enjoy mountain
views from our 8 by 50 foot covered porch, which has 4 jumbo rocking
chairs and a swing for your enjoyment. You can hear the birds and
even our local hoot owl while enjoying nature from our porch. A
large deck adjoins the front of the house with a view of our
beautiful man-made waterfall. Deck also features a gas grill and
picnic table. The cabin is conveniently located approximately 20
minutes from downtown Waynesville, 20 minutes from Maggie Valley, 30
minutes fromAsheville, and 45 minutes from Harrah's Casino in
Cherokee. Come stay at Cataloochee Mountain Cabin for your perfect
mountain getaway. The community area includes a pond with fish and
ducks, a picnic area with table and grill, volleyball net and a
treehouse.
